Subject: [PATCH 21/22] gc: mark unused descriptors in scheduler callbacks
Date: Mon, 28 Aug 2023 17:48:23 -0400	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20230828214823.GU3831137@coredump.intra.peff.net>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20230828214604.GA3830831@coredump.intra.peff.net>

Each of the scheduler update callbacks gets the descriptor of the lock
file, but only the crontab updater needs it. We have to retain the
unused descriptors because these are dispatched from a table of function
pointers, but we should mark them to silence -Wunused-parameter.

Signed-off-by: Jeff King <peff@peff.net>
---
 builtin/gc.c | 6 +++---
 1 file changed, 3 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-)

diff --git a/builtin/gc.c b/builtin/gc.c
index 1f53b66c7b..369bd43fb2 100644
--- a/builtin/gc.c
+++ b/builtin/gc.c
@@ -1934,7 +1934,7 @@ static int launchctl_add_plists(void)
 	       launchctl_schedule_plist(exec_path, SCHEDULE_WEEKLY);
 }
 
-static int launchctl_update_schedule(int run_maintenance, int fd)
+static int launchctl_update_schedule(int run_maintenance, int fd UNUSED)
 {
 	if (run_maintenance)
 		return launchctl_add_plists();
@@ -2115,7 +2115,7 @@ static int schtasks_schedule_tasks(void)
 	       schtasks_schedule_task(exec_path, SCHEDULE_WEEKLY);
 }
 
-static int schtasks_update_schedule(int run_maintenance, int fd)
+static int schtasks_update_schedule(int run_maintenance, int fd UNUSED)
 {
 	if (run_maintenance)
 		return schtasks_schedule_tasks();
@@ -2556,7 +2556,7 @@ static int systemd_timer_setup_units(void)
 	return ret;
 }
 
-static int systemd_timer_update_schedule(int run_maintenance, int fd)
+static int systemd_timer_update_schedule(int run_maintenance, int fd UNUSED)
 {
 	if (run_maintenance)
 		return systemd_timer_setup_units();
